H.C.R. No. 10 


HOUSE CONCURRENT RESOLUTION
WHEREAS, The St. Mark's School of Texas wrestling team earned its 500th dual meet victory on December 14, 2002, and this outstanding achievement provides a fitting opportunity to recognize a remarkable athletic program; and WHEREAS, St. Mark's School of Texas has dominated the sport of wrestling through the years, as evidenced by the team's four state championships, three preparatory state championships, 12 regional championships, and 17 Southwest Preparatory Conference championships; and WHEREAS, For the past 21 years, head coach Rick Ortega has provided his charges with exceptional leadership and inspiration; during his tenure, he has produced 43 individual state champions and 35 preparatory All-Americans, and he was honored as the 1998-1999 Region 6 Coach of the Year; and WHEREAS, The wrestling team members are outstanding student-athletes; with their coaches and staff, they are a source of pride to all those associated with St. Mark's School of Texas, and they truly merit congratulations for their success;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the 78th Legislature of the State of Texas hereby honor the St. Mark's School of Texas wrestling team on its 500th dual meet victory and extend to its coaches and athletes best wishes for the future;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for St. Mark's School of Texas as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ives and Senate.
